Week of 9.24 to 9.28

9/28/2018

0 Comments

 
This week essentially served as a Quarter 1  review; an opportunity to slow down and process our content. We started the week off with a story building assignment, where students were assigned a topic and asked to write a topic sentence, they then crumpled up their paper and threw it in the classroom. Students retrieved a new paper and built on the topic sentence written down. By the end of class we had 20 completed paragraphs with each student having contributed to five topics. Notes and textbooks were available for this work.
Tuesday and Wednesday were spent working on a project. Students were given five project options with guidelines explicitly laid out. Students displayed their projects on Thursday, where we did a gallery walk and used rubrics to view and grade each others' work. 
We end the week with a scavenger hunt around the school, the idea was courtesy of Mr. Finney. 

Benchmarks took place this week so we could check-in on students' progress. Please remind your student to take these very seriously as conversations about their progress are focused around these monthly assessments.

Next week, the topic in class is westward movement in Georgia. We'll focus on land distribution, the movement of capitols, the establishment of UGA, and the impact of both railroads and the cotton gin.

Week of 9.17 to 9.21

9/24/2018

0 Comments

 
Last week students assessed the weaknesses in our government's first form under the Articles of Confederation. Learning about these sets up an understanding of concepts to be argued again leading up to the Civil War. Students were given different assignments by the week's end to support their learning of specific content based on results from a quick, in-class assessment. 

This week, we are slowing down to ensure depth of knowledge on topics covered so far this year. Monday starts with the trial of a new activity called Team Story Build, where students are tasked to contribute one sentence to 5 different topics as they traded papers in class. Tuesday and Wednesday will be project days, where students will have a choice of 5 projects to choose from. Thursday will be a gallery walk where students will view each others' completed projects and give peer feedback. We will close the week with a treasure hunt activity put together by Mr. Finney.

Week of 9.3 to 9.7

9/10/2018

0 Comments

 
Last week students learned about some of the events that caused tensions between the American colonies and Britain. 
Students had an online forum to ask questions while watching a video, they were taken outside but only granted freedom to play if able to relate their trapped scenario to King George's Proclamation of 1763, and then students were tasked with interpreting excerpts from the Declaration of Independence as their graded assignment for the week.

Next week we will learn more about events of the war as they relate to Georgia. Students will produce E-Notes with rubrics for what to include on each slide.
